Are people in Vail older or younger than people in Omaha?- The Median Age in Vail is 4.5 years older than in Omaha.
Are housing costs cheaper in Vail or Omaha?- Vail
housing costs are 62.1% more expensive than Omaha housing costs.
Which city has a longer commute, Vail or Omaha?- The average commute for residents of Vail is 11.5 minutes longer than it is for residents of Omaha.
Things to do in Omaha?Omaha, Nebraska is a vibrant city situated on the Missouri River. With its thriving art and music scene, eclectic dining establishments, and impressive outdoor attractions, there is something for everyone in Omaha. From the world-famous Henry Doorly Zoo to the beautiful Memorial Park and Wildlife Safari, visitors have plenty of options to explore. Culture and history buffs will appreciate the city's many museums while shoppers can find all they need at Westroads Mall or Omaha's Old Market.
Things to do in Vail?Vail, AZ is an unincorporated community found northeast of Tucson featuring activities available at nearby Colossal Cave Mountain Park ideal for outdoor lovers including hikes up to panoramic views of the valley, horseback riding along canyon sides and even geocaching through its desert lands.
